Архитектор информационных систем

Автор: Артём Орлов
Обновлено
Архитектор информационных систем

Архитектор информационных систем (software architect) разрабатывает и развивает архитектуру программного обеспечения (ПО) так, чтобы она  соответствовала текущим потребностям заказчика (чаще всего бизнеса) и была способна модернизироваться под его будущие нужды. Кстати, недавно центр профориентации ПрофГид разработал точный тест на профориентацию, который сам расскажет, какие профессии вам подходят, даст заключение о вашем типе личности и интеллекте. Профессия подходит тем, кого интересует информатика (см. выбор профессии по интересу к школьным предметам).

Содержание:

Краткое описание

Главная задача архитектора информационных систем (ИС) – разработка архитектуры программного обеспечения проекта, но также довольно часто на его плечи ложится работа по написанию технической документации, оценка сроков и сложности реализации нового функционала, иногда настройка процессов разработки и код-ревью.

В зависимости от типа и размера компании работа архитектора ИС может довольно сильно отличаться. Если компания крупная и бизнес-процессы медленные, то часто архитектор проектирует на уровне диаграмм, в то время как в более мелких и динамичных компаниях он будет тесно общаться с программистами и даже писать код на архитектурном уровне.

Профессия более редкая, чем программист, но и специалистов гораздо меньше. За хорошего архитектора информационных систем работодатель будет готов отдать многое.

  • Подготовка к ЕГЭ 2023: видеокурсы без воды
    Подготовка к ЕГЭ 2023: видеокурсы без воды
    В 15 раз дешевле репетитора
  • Подготовься к ЕГЭ, ОГЭ с нуля на максимум за 8,5 месяцев!
    Подготовься к ЕГЭ, ОГЭ с нуля на максимум за 8,5 месяцев!
    Команда Умскул сделает всё, чтобы вы успешно сдали экзамены и достигли своих целей. Успейте записаться до конца лета с 10% скидкой!
Георгий Андрончик
Fullstack-программист и архитектор ПО

Особенности профессии

Создание архитектуры информационных систем требует от специалиста глубоких профессиональных знаний и математического склада ума. В обязанности архитектора ИС входит выполнение таких задач:

  • разработка архитектуры и поддержание существующей;
  • общение с бизнесом, выявление требований к системе;
  • оценка сроков и стоимости разработки функционала;
  • постановка задач разработчикам;
  • контроль соблюдения разработчиками архитектурных паттернов, заложенных архитектором;
  • настройка процессов разработки.

Архитектор информационных систем – это связующее звено между бизнесом и программистами. Он слышит, что нужно бизнесу, и перекладывает это на язык программирования. Поэтому такой специалист должен быть не только крутым технарем, но и иметь хорошие коммуникативные навыки.

Георгий Андрончик
Fullstack-программист и архитектор ПО

Плюсы и минусы

Плюсы

  •  Дефицит архитекторов информационных систем, что обусловливает высокие зарплаты.
  •  Востребованность в любой отрасли бизнеса и госструктурах.
  •  Профессия дает возможность прокачать знания, перейти на новую ветвь профессионального развития специалистам с техническим образованием.
  •  Профессия престижная, а работа интересная.
  •  Перспективы трудоустройства в крупную компанию, расширения деловых связей.

Минусы

  • Необходим серьезный бэкграунд в программировании либо системном анализе. Человек без опыта не сможет стать архитектором ИС.
  • Ненормированный рабочий день, высокие психоэмоциональные нагрузки.
  • Огромная ответственность.
  • Сидячая работа, из-за которой у специалистов старше 40–45 лет нарушается зрение, возникают проблемы с опорно-двигательным аппаратом.
  • Требовательность руководства, причем многие заказчики не всегда понимают специфики работы архитектора, что может привести к разногласиям.

Важные личные качества

Профессия сложная и не позволяет стоять на месте, поэтому специалист должен быть открыт для получения новых знаний. Для архитектора информационных систем очень важны: 

  • усидчивость;
  • стрессоустойчивость;
  • склонность к руководящей работе;
  • аналитическое, логическое и критическое мышление;
  • целеустремленность;
  • уверенность в себе;
  • эрудированность;
  • инициативность.

Обучение на архитектора информационных систем

Чтобы стать архитектором ИС, необходимо хорошо ориентироваться в программировании или системном анализе и знать основы архитектуры ПО. Также надо иметь несколько лет коммерческого опыта работы в ИТ.

Георгий Андрончик
Fullstack-программист и архитектор ПО
  • «Информационные системы и технологии» 09.03.02.
  • «Информатика и вычислительная техника» 09.03.01.
  • «Прикладная информатика» 09.03.03.
  • «Программная инженерия» 09.03.04.
  • «Системный анализ и управление» 27.03.03.
  • «Специальные организационно-технические системы» 27.05.01.

При поступлении на эти направления и специальности профильные предметы математика, физика/информатика – по выбору вуза.

Учеба в вузе будет только первым шагом. Тонкости построения архитектуры информационных систем придется постигать на курсах.

Самый простой и понятный способ стать архитектором информационных систем – это стать бэкенд-программистом, после чего подтянуть архитектурную базу. Однако можно перейти в архитекторы не только из бэкенда, но и других областей программирования и даже из системных аналитиков. Получив коммерческий опыт, вы можете подучиться на курсах, например Skillbox «Архитектор ПО». При наличии опыта и после окончания курсов, у вас есть реальные шансы получить работу архитектора ИС.

Георгий Андрончик
Fullstack-программист и архитектор ПО

Место работы

Архитекторы, создающие информационные системы, востребованы в любых компаниях. Они работают на производственных предприятиях, в крупных корпорациях, государственных структурах и других учреждениях, нуждающихся в простых, понятных и надежных ИС. Большие компании принимают этих специалистов в штат, маленькие – привлекают на определенный срок, чтобы сэкономить бюджет.

Оплата труда

Зарплата архитектора информационных систем на август 2022

Информации о зарплатах предоставлена порталом hh.ru.

Россия 75000—300000₽
Москва 103000—450000₽

Архитектор информационных систем – хорошая ступень в карьере ИТ-инженера. После нее можно становиться техническим директором, открывать свою компанию или продолжать развиваться как архитектор, накапливая финансовый и интеллектуальный капитал.

Георгий Андрончик
Fullstack-программист и архитектор ПО

Курсы

Вузы

Примеры компаний с вакансиями архитектора информационных систем

  • Менеджер по работе с заказчиками (Информационная безопасность)
  • Системный архитектор программного обеспечения
  • Архитектор IT (OLAP)
  • Enterprise архитектор
  • Директор ИТ
  • Principal UX/UI Designer
star_rate star_rate star_rate star_rate star_rate